Andrew Lavin appears as a contributor on The Book Review podcast, where he participates in roundtable discussions about contemporary fiction and shares reading recommendations with listeners. During an episode in July 2024, Lavin brought up Katie Kitamura's novel Intimacies, noting that he had recently finished reading it as the author's latest work of fiction. In addition to discussing this recent release, Lavin also referenced Kitamura's previous novel, A Separation, during the conversation to provide broader context about the author's body of work and literary style. Through these mentions on The Book Review, Lavin highlights notable modern fiction and engages with the literary landscape by examining works that explore complex interpersonal relationships and narrative tension.
